Overview and production context

This 3D model depicts a dark knight in a commanding pose, fully encased in detailed, dark metallic plate armor. The armor features sharp, angular designs, a menacing helmet with glowing red eyes, and a tattered cape, evoking a sense of dread and power. The texture suggests weathered metal, hinting at countless battles fought. This model is ideal for creating imposing characters in fantasy games, dark-themed renders, or as a striking collectible miniature.

How to use this model

Use cases, fit and pre-production checks

This dark knight model is optimized for 3D printing, with a solid mesh suitable for FDM and resin printers. Consider printing at a 1:10 or 1:12 scale for detailed miniatures, ensuring supports are used for the cape and outstretched arms. For game development and AR/VR, the model's clean topology makes it easy to integrate into engines like Unity or Unreal Engine. Its dark, imposing aesthetic also makes it a perfect asset for creating atmospheric scenes in architectural visualizations or for use as a dramatic display piece in a digital collection.
